All, In the previous e-mail, [1] was recommending 3rd party ci to pin zuul to v. 2.1.0, but this has pip dependency conflicts with nodepool 0.3.0 when installed on the same VM (common case typical for 3rd party ci) causing zuul service to fail to start. This is fixed by using the newly created zuul v. 2.5.0 tag [2], which has compatible pip dependencies along with many bug fixes.
It is strongly recommended to apply this pins to your setup and NOT use master branch in order to keep you CI systems stable. The full set of recommended pins is being maintained in this file [3]. Ramy [1] https://review.openstack.org/#/c/348035/4/contrib/single_node_ci_data.yaml [2] https://review.openstack.org/#/c/352560/1/contrib/single_node_ci_data.yaml [3] http://git.openstack.org/cgit/openstack-infra/puppet-openstackci/tree/contrib/single_node_ci_data.yaml -----Original Message----- From: Asselin, Ramy Sent: Friday, August 05, 2016 11:29 AM To: OpenStack Development Mailing List (not for usage questions) <openstack-dev@lists.openstack.org> Subject: [openstack-dev] [third-party] [ci] Please PIN your 3rd party ci setup to JJB 1.6.1 All, In case you're still using JJB master branch, it is highly recommended that you pin to 1.6.1. There are recent/upcoming changes that could break your CI setup. You can do this by updating your puppet hiera file (/etc/puppet/environments/common.yaml [1]) as shown here [2][3] Re-run puppet (sudo puppet apply --verbose /etc/puppet/manifests/site.pp [1]) and that will ensure your JJB & zuul installations are pinned to stable versions. Ramy [1] http://docs.openstack.org/infra/openstackci/third_party_ci.html [2] diff: https://review.openstack.org/#/c/348035/4/contrib/single_node_ci_data.yaml [3] full: http://git.openstack.org/cgit/openstack-infra/puppet-openstackci/tree/contrib/single_node_ci_data.yaml -----Original Message----- From: Asselin, Ramy Sent: Friday, July 08, 2016 7:30 AM To: OpenStack Development Mailing List (not for usage questions) <openstack-dev@lists.openstack.org> Subject: [openstack-dev] [third-party] [ci] Upcoming changes to Nodepool for Zuul v3 All, If you haven't already, it's recommended to pin nodepool to the 0.3.0 tag and not use master. If you're using the puppet-openstackci solution, you can update your puppet hiera file as shown here: https://review.openstack.org/293112 Re-run puppet and restart nodepool. Ramy -----Original Message----- From: Monty Taylor [mailto:mord...@inaugust.com] Sent: Thursday, July 07, 2016 6:21 PM To: openstack-in...@lists.openstack.org Subject: [OpenStack-Infra] Upcoming changes to Nodepool for Zuul v3 Hey all! tl;dr - nodepool 0.3.0 tagged, you should pin Longer version: As you are probably aware, we've been working towards Zuul v3 for a while. Hopefully you're as excited about that as we are. We're about to start working in earnest on changes to nodepool in support of that. One of our goals with Zuul v3 is to make nodepool supportable in a CD manner for people who are not us. In support of that, we may break a few things over the next month or two. So that it's not a steady stream of things you should pay attention to - we've cut a tag: 0.3.0 of what's running in production right now. If your tolerance for potentially breaking change is low, we strongly recommend pinning your install to it. We will still be running CD from master the whole time - but we are also paying constant attention when we're landing things. Once this next iteration is ready, we'll send out another announcement that master is in shape for consuming CD-style. Thanks! Monty _______________________________________________ OpenStack-Infra mailing list openstack-in...@lists.openstack.org http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-infra __________________________________________________________________________ OpenStack Development Mailing List (not for usage questions) Unsubscribe: openstack-dev-requ...@lists.openstack.org?subject:unsubscribe http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ev __________________________________________________________________________ OpenStack Development Mailing List (not for usage questions) Unsubscribe: openstack-dev-requ...@lists.openstack.org?subject:unsubscribe http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ev __________________________________________________________________________ OpenStack Development Mailing List (not for usage questions) Unsubscribe: openstack-dev-requ...@lists.openstack.org?subject:unsubscribe http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ev